 Monday, September 12, 2005

Scheduled Time: 30:00
Actual Time: 45:54
RPE: 3

I'm feeling pretty good right now, because my run today was the longest I've ever run in my life (time-wise).  I could have kept going, but decided not to get too over-excited.  It's a relief, because my last run on Saturday, I pooped out before the 30 minutes was up.  I noticed that I had run a much faster pace than normal, and I just couldn't last.  Today, I concentrated on maintaining a slower pace, so that I could go the full 30 minutes.  Also, I read about running form in my book, and I had to pay attention to running more forward and less up-and-down.  Something else that may have contributed to the extended time was that I had a Balance bar about an hour before the run.  Normally, I eat one after the run, but I think I'm going to try this hour before thing for a while.  The RPE mentioned above is the rate of perceived exertion, where 0 is no exertion and 10 is maximal exertion.  My lungs had no problems with the run today; I only noticed my breathing once or twice.  My only physical complaint is my left leg.  There's kind of a dull ache somewhere in the lower portion; it's hard to pinpoint.  I'm hoping that this will be solved when I get new running shoes in two weeks when I visit Jeff and Road Runner Sports in San Diego.

Today I am officially starting my pre-training for a half-marathon.  Actually, I'm following the training for a full marathon (from this book), but my plan is to run the half-marathon in Carlsbad on January 15th with recently engaged Jeff Webdell.  Depending on how the whole process works out, I may then search out a marathon in which to attempt to murder myself.  I say pre-training, because the prerequisite for the book training program is that I be comfortable running for 2 weeks, 4 times a week for 30 minutes.  Now, I have been in pre-pre-training, during which time I have been running 3 times a week for 30 minutes or more.  I'm posting my training schedule here, and then I hope to report back on my progress as things move along.

Pre-training
9/12 - Run 30 minutes
9/14 - Run 30 minutes
9/15 - Run 30 minutes
9/17 - Run 30 minutes
9/19 - Run 30 minutes
9/21 - Run 30 minutes
9/22 - Run 30 minutes
9/24 - Run 30 minutes

Training
9/26 - 3 miles
9/28 - 4 miles
9/29 - 3 miles
10/1 - 5 miles
10/3 - 3 miles
10/5 - 4 miles
10/6 - 3 miles
10/8 - 6 miles
10/10 - 3 miles
10/12 - 4 miles
10/13 - 3 miles
10/15 - 7 miles
10/17 - 3 miles
10/19 - 5 miles
10/20 - 3 miles
10/22 - 8 miles
10/24 - 3 miles
10/26 - 5 miles
10/27 - 3 miles
10/29 - 10 miles
10/31 - 4 miles
11/2 - 5 miles
11/3 - 4 miles
11/5 - 11 miles
11/7 - 4 miles
11/9 - 6 miles
11/10 - 4 miles
11/12 - 12 miles
11/14 - 4 miles
11/16 - 6 miles
11/17 - 4 miles
11/19 - 14 miles
11/21 - 4 miles
11/23 - 7 miles (in Vegas)
11/24 - 4 miles
11/26 - 16 miles
11/28 - 5 miles
11/30 - 8 miles
12/1 - 5 miles
12/3 - 16 miles
12/5 - 5 miles
12/7 - 8 miles
12/8 - 5 miles
12/10 - 16 miles
12/12 - 5 miles
12/14 - 8 miles
12/15 - 5 miles
12/17 - 18 miles
12/19 - 5 miles
12/21 - 8 miles
12/22 - 5 miles
12/24 - 18 miles (Merry Christmas?)
12/26 - 5 miles
12/28 - 8 miles
12/29 - 5 miles
12/31 - 9 miles
1/2 - 3 miles
1/4 - 5 miles
1/5 - 3 miles
1/7 - 8 miles
1/9 - 3 miles
1/11 - 3 miles
1/13 - Walk 3 miles
1/15 - Run 13.1 miles at the San Diego Half Marathon
